Water

Other Names: Aqua; H2O; Eau; Aqueous; Acqua
Function: Solvent

1. Definition Water:

Water is a common ingredient in cosmetics, used as a solvent to dissolve other ingredients, as a carrier for active ingredients, and to provide hydration and moisture to the skin.

2. Use:

Water is a crucial component in cosmetics as it helps to create the desired texture and consistency of products. It also serves as a medium for other ingredients to mix together effectively and evenly. Additionally, water helps to hydrate the skin and improve the overall feel and application of cosmetic products.

3. Usage Water:

When using cosmetics that contain water, it is important to be mindful of the expiration date and storage conditions. Water-based products are susceptible to bacterial growth, so it is essential to avoid contaminating the product by using clean hands or tools when applying. It is also recommended to store water-based cosmetics in a cool, dry place to prevent the growth of mold and bacteria.

Hydroxyapatite

Function: Emulsion Stabilising, Abrasive, Bulking Agent

1. Definition Hydroxyapatite:

Hydroxyapatite is a naturally occurring mineral form of calcium apatite, with the chemical formula Ca5(PO4)3(OH). It is the main mineral component of bone and teeth, providing strength and rigidity to these tissues.

2. Use:

In cosmetics, hydroxyapatite is used for its ability to promote collagen production, improve skin elasticity, and enhance overall skin health. It is commonly found in anti-aging products, as it can help reduce the appearance of fine lines and wrinkles.

Cetearyl Nonanoate

Function: Emollient

1. Definition Cetearyl Nonanoate:

Cetearyl Nonanoate is a fatty acid ester derived from cetearyl alcohol and nonanoic acid. It is commonly used in cosmetics as an emollient and skin conditioning agent.

2. Use:

Cetearyl Nonanoate is known for its ability to provide a smooth and soft texture to cosmetic products. It is often included in formulations such as creams, lotions, and serums to improve the spreadability and overall feel of the product on the skin. Additionally, it helps to lock in moisture and prevent water loss, making it a popular ingredient in moisturizing products.

Dodecane

Function: Perfuming

1. Definition Dodecane:

Dodecane is a colorless, odorless liquid hydrocarbon with the chemical formula C12H26. It belongs to the class of alkanes, which are saturated hydrocarbons that are commonly used in various industries including cosmetics.

2. Use:

Dodecane is often used in cosmetics as a solvent, carrier agent, or emollient. It helps to dissolve other ingredients in formulations and can improve the spreadability of products on the skin. Dodecane is also known for its lightweight and non-greasy texture, making it a popular choice in skincare and haircare products.
